Human C-terminal CUBN variants associate with chronic proteinuria and normal renal function

BACKGROUND: Proteinuria is considered an unfavorable clinical condition that accelerates renal and cardiovascular disease. However, it is not clear whether all forms of proteinuria are damaging.
